Accommodation
I stayed in a 8 sharing dorm. The cost is 354 Euros per month and 10 Euros per month for internet as well.
Exams
My score: IELTS overall 8.5, Required overall 6.5, min 6 in each category, Others are not mandatory. CV mandatory ; LOR and SOP not mandatory.
